Re: antenna options

Options are simple. Either replace it with another power antenna or replace it with a regular one. It's that simple.

I replaced my bad power antenna years ago with another power antenna. It finally died last year and I replaced it with a regular shorty style antenna to save weight and money since this antenna only costed $6 versus $36 for a power one. Not to mention that when a power antenna dies, your reception is crap but this little guy will work forever. You can score any of them at Pep Boys, etc.
